Reduce lock level for ALTER DOMAIN ... VALIDATE CONSTRAINT

Reduce from ShareLock to ShareUpdateExclusivelock.  Validation during
ALTER DOMAIN ... ADD CONSTRAINT keeps using ShareLock.

Example:

    create domain d1 as int;
    create table t (a d1);
    alter domain d1 add constraint cc10 check (value > 10) not valid;

    begin;
    alter domain d1 validate constraint cc10;

    -- another session
    insert into t values (8);

Now we should still be able to perform DML operations on table t while
the domain constraint is being validated.  The equivalent works
already on table constraints.
